返回

提升网站效率——Vue静态资源CDN方案

前端

对于现代Web应用程序,尤其是Vue.js构建的应用来说,静态资源的管理和优化尤为重要。为了提升网站的加载速度和用户体验,使用CDN(内容分发网络)来托管和加速静态资源已经成为最佳实践之一。本文将深入探讨Vue.js静态资源的CDN方案,提供实用的实现步骤和配置建议,助力您的Vue.js应用程序飞速运行!

CDN简介:加速静态资源的利器
CDN(内容分发网络)是一种分布式系统,它将静态资源(例如图像、样式表、脚本等)存储在全球各地的数据中心,从而提高访问速度和可用性。当用户请求这些资源时,CDN会从最近的数据中心提供服务,从而缩短加载时间和提高性能。

CDN的优势:网站性能的福音
使用CDN托管静态资源可以带来诸多优势:

  • 提升加载速度: 通过将静态资源存储在更靠近用户的服务器上,CDN可以显著缩短加载时间,提高网站的整体性能。
  • 增强可用性: CDN具有冗余特性,这意味着如果一个数据中心出现故障,其他数据中心可以继续提供服务,确保网站的可用性。
  • 减轻服务器负载: CDN可以帮助减轻服务器的负担,因为静态资源的请求会直接从CDN服务器发出,从而减少对服务器的压力。
  • 改善用户体验: 更快的加载速度和更高的可用性可以显著改善用户体验,提高网站的粘性和转化率。

Vue.js静态资源CDN实现步骤:从搭建到配置
要在Vue.js应用程序中使用CDN托管静态资源,可以按照以下步骤进行:

  1. 选择CDN服务提供商: 目前市面上有许多CDN服务提供商,例如七牛云、阿里云CDN、又拍云等。您可以根据自己的需求和预算选择合适的提供商。
  2. 创建CDN项目: 在您选择的CDN服务提供商处创建一个项目,并获取CDN域名。
  3. 配置Vue.js构建工具: 在Vue.js项目中,您需要配置构建工具(例如webpack、Rollup等)以支持CDN。具体配置方式因构建工具而异,但一般都需要将CDN域名作为静态资源的公共路径。
  4. 上传静态资源到CDN: 将Vue.js应用程序构建生成的静态资源(例如js、css、图片等)上传到CDN的存储空间。
  5. 更新资源路径: 在Vue.js应用程序中,您需要将静态资源的路径更新为CDN域名。
  6. 测试CDN效果: 部署应用程序后,您可以使用浏览器开发者工具或第三方工具来测试CDN的效果,确保静态资源能够从CDN服务器快速加载。

CDN配置建议:性能优化的关键
为了获得最佳的CDN性能,您还可以进行以下配置优化:

  • 选择合适的CDN节点: 在CDN服务提供商处选择离用户最近的CDN节点,以缩短加载时间。
  • 开启CDN缓存: 大多数CDN服务提供商都提供缓存功能,这可以帮助减少重复请求,从而提高性能。
  • 设置合理的缓存时间: 为不同的静态资源设置合理的缓存时间,以在性能和更新之间取得平衡。
  • 启用GZIP压缩: GZIP压缩可以减小静态资源的大小,从而提高加载速度。
  • 使用CDN预热: CDN预热是指在应用程序上线前将静态资源预先加载到CDN节点,以避免首次请求的延迟。

Vue.js静态资源CDN方案:飞速网站的秘诀
通过使用CDN托管Vue.js静态资源,您可以显著提升网站的加载速度、增强可用性和减轻服务器负载,从而改善用户体验和提高网站的整体性能。遵循本文提供的步骤和配置建议,您将能够轻松实现Vue.js静态资源的CDN加速,为您的网站插上腾飞的翅膀!